Are all the SLB Ionic Liquid Capillary Columns GC-MS compatible?
1 answer-
SLB-IL59, SLB-IL60, SLB-IL61, SLB-IL76, SLB-IL82, SLB-IL100 and SLB-IL111 Ionic Liquid Capillary Columns are all GC-MS compatible.
